I don´t know if this question belongs here, but I´m currently building a Huey Gunship and I´m curious about the flight engineer and his role.

I´ve seen multiple pictures of armed UH-1Cs (I´m building the "C" in 1:72, Hobbyboss-kit - I know of all the shortcomings of this specific kit) where - in addition to the XM-21 system I´m going to use - M60s on bungee-lines or mounts are fitted.

So, question is: On every flight? One M60 on each side, or maybe only one side, the other one "clear"? Any input is highly appreciated.

HAJO

I'd say it'd be safe to put two in. It would depend on unit procedure, but most of the pictures I can find show two gunners.
